How To Fix BP234 - Version may not be copied onto itself


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: BP - Budgeting and planning

  • Message number: 234

  • Message text: Version may not be copied onto itself

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    You tried to copy a version even though the source and target are
    identical.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    Change the parameters so that the source and target are not identical.
